ATL vs MIA Dream11: The NBA Playoffs are in full flow and we have seen various intense battles throughout the Postseason. To make my point home, there are two tied series in the West while the matters in the East may look a little simple, they can be complicated. The Celtics are up by three-nil, the 76ers are up by three-one, the Bucks are up by two-one. Meanwhile, the Miami Heat will look to grab a three-one lead versus the Atlanta Hawks while the Hawks will look to level things.

The Hawks won the last game as Trae Young made a tough floater as the Hawks outscored the Heat 34:25 in the final Quarter and of course, it was Young who did the most damage. Late in the game, the Heat was unable to perform and their isolation sets were rather painful to watch. The Heat will have to learn to close out games if they are to make a deep run.

Big game for the Hawks

Although Trae continued to be off from the three-point line, his late charge proved a point; the Hawks need him to fire on all cylinders. The Heat once again did a great job guarding him but it was the balanced scoring of the Hawks that proved to be decisive. Hunter and Bogdanovic scored 17 and 18 respectively while one of the major contributions by the bench player Delon Wright, who nailed 18 points.

The Heat shot just 31.1% from the three-point line in the last game and despite a 45:36 rebounds advantage, a late-game collapse took the game away from them. Strus had another strong shooting night, clipping home five out of his three-point shots. The Heat dished 30 assists and despite doing most of the things right, it call came to close out games.

For the Hawks, the shooting percentage of 51 was impressive and that is something that was missing in the first two games. They also forced 14 turnovers and did a great job of also reducing them compared to the first two games. Although there were some promising trends for the Hawks in the last game, they have their work cut out in various ways. Will they be able to respond in the same fashion in Game 5?
